Help identifying older Ti frame please

I bought this bike a few years ago because I wanted a Ti bike that would last a long time. I have researched and read forums all over. However, being a small number of bikes initially, makes connecting the dots on mine a little difficult. I believe it’s a spectrum frame from the early 90’s but have nothing, other than speculation, to base that on. There is internal top tube cable routing and some nice seat tube detail. The grease guard BB makes me lean to Merlin and Spectrum. I bought it with Merlin decals, but anyone can slap those on a a Ti frame. It was also painted at one point, though it came off very easily when I decided to go that route.

my frame # is 216, I cant post pics or links until I have 10 posts, I'll see what I can do on that...

Any help is greatly appreciated!!!
